When I open up a Pub 2003 document on a computer that did not create the
document, the fonts that are missing on the current computer are listed as
the document is opened. These missing fonts are only those used in text
boxes, not the fonts used in word art. The word art just defaults to an
arial font. When I open the "edit text" menu in word art, the font box is
blank.

Do I have a setting wrong or is this just how it is with Publisher 2003?

No, that's the way things are. I think it's to do with Publisher's
WordArt deriving from Office's shared drawing features (Escher), whereas
the text box was designed especially for Publisher.
